Solution Overview

Problem

Users face difficulties in intuitively selecting suitable graphical objects to represent complex data sets, especially multidimensional data, in computing environments, as they lack the sophistication in graphics design to make appropriate choices.

Innovation Solution

A computerized tool that allows users to incrementally build the visual representation of a data set by identifying and suggesting suitable visual display components based on the data set's characteristics, which can modify existing graphical objects or augment them with new components to effectively represent different portions of the data.

Data Source

PatentUS8823711B2Incremental creation of a graphical object to visually represent a data set
Publication Date: 2014.09.02 MICROSOFT TECHNOLOGY LICENSING LLC

AI summary

A computerized tool to visually display data using a graphical object. Visual display components may be identified that can represent a portion of the data and may be proposed to a user, based on visual characteristics of each of the visual display components and parameter(s) of the data. A visual display component selected from these components based on user input may be linked to the portion of the data set so that the visual display component will modify the appearance of the graphical object in a way that represents the portion of the data. Different visual display components may be identified and suggested for a user's selection to represent other portions of the data using the graphical object. The graphical object may thus be incrementally refined to ultimately result in the visual representation of the data.
